An absolutely outstanding achievement - huge congratulations to Barrosa Company Sergeant Major and G Company Sergeant Major on successfully passing the highly demanding Master Cadet Course at the National Army Cadet Training Centre, Frimley Park. 👏🏽

Widely regarded as one of the most challenging and prestigious courses within the Army Cadets, the Master Cadet Course pushes Cadets to their absolute limits, testing leadership, resilience, knowledge, and determination at the highest level. Only a select few ever reach this standard, and even fewer successfully complete it.

Both cadets have demonstrated exceptional commitment, professionalism, and perseverance throughout, setting themselves apart as true role models within the Battalion. Their success is a testament not only to their ability, but to the countless hours of hard work and dedication invested along the way.

This is an achievement to be incredibly proud of, raising the bar and inspiring cadets across the board.

Very well done both, thoroughly deserved and richly earned. 👏🏽☘️

We are incredibly proud to congratulate Army Cadet Staff Sergeant Sam Carter, of Comber Detachment, G Company, on his outstanding success this weekend in passing the interview board and being selected for promotion to Barrosa Senior Training Company Sergeant Major. 👏🏽

Sam’s journey within the Army Cadet Force has been nothing short of exemplary. Throughout his cadet tenure, he has consistently demonstrated exceptional dedication, discipline, and leadership well beyond his rank. Respected by fellow Cadets and Adult Volunteers alike, Sam has set the standard through his professionalism, commitment to training, and unwavering support of fellow cadets.

Pictured is the current Barrosa Company Cadet CSM, William Magill, handing over the Barrosa pace stick to Sam - a proud handover of leadership and responsibility, reinforcing the high standards and excellence of Barrosa Senior Training Company.

Sam will formally assume the role from William on 9th February, and we are confident he will embrace this opportunity with the same drive, integrity, and passion that has defined his cadet career to date.

Congratulations Sam, an exceptional achievement and a very well-earned promotion. We look forward to seeing you thrive in your new role. 💪🏽☘️

We are delighted to announce that the Christmas Sponsored Walk carried out by Comber Army Cadets just before Christmas has raised an impressive £1,000. 🎉

This total was made possible through the hard work and determination of our Comber Army Cadets, along with the invaluable support and organisation provided by our Adult Volunteers. The money raised will be shared equally, with £500 going to the Army Cadet Charitable Trust NI (ACCT NI) and £500 donated to Walking With The Wounded.

The sponsored walk was a real test of endurance and teamwork, and the way our Cadets rose to the challenge reflects great credit on them all.

A sincere thank you to everyone who took part, supported the event, and donated. This was an excellent achievement and a very positive way to end the year for Comber Army Cadets. Well done! 👏🏽☘️

Congratulations to our Battalion Honorary Colonel, Air Chief Marshal Sir Harvey Smyth, CB, OBE, DFC, on his appointment as a Knight Commander in His Majesty’s New Year Honours List 2026.

This well-deserved recognition reflects a lifetime of outstanding service, leadership and dedication. Sir Harvey began his distinguished journey as an Army Cadet with 2nd (NI) Battalion ACF, and we are immensely proud to have such an inspirational figure as our Honorary Colonel. We celebrate this significant honour with great pride.

Congratulations, Sir!
